Patriots Waive Kai Forbath

The New England Patriots waived kicker Kai Forbath on Monday, according to sources. In a corresponding move, the Pats claimed defensive tackle Albert Huggins off waivers from the Eagles. Forbath was filling in for Nick Folk, who had an appendectomy, in Week 13 and missed one of two extra-point tries in the Sunday night loss […]


Patriots Defense Gets Humbled By Texans

The New England Patriots Defense recorded three sacks and zero turnovers in the team's 28-22 loss to the Texans in Week 13. The defense was put on their heels early after quarterback Tom Brady threw a costly interception that set up a short-field for the Texans. The Patriots defense was on pace for all-time numbers […]
